Переключите Ctrl и Высокий звук с AutoHotKey, не портя переключатель Alt-Tab?

Я хочу переключить Ctrl и клавиши Alt в Windows XP. Я создал сценарий AutoHotKey, который содержит следующее:

LAlt::LCtrl
RAlt::RCtrl

LCtrl::LAlt
RCtrl::RAlt

Это работает, но единственная проблема состоит в том, что переключатель Alt-Tab застревает. Когда я выпускаю Alt-Tab, переключатель окна остается вплоть до, я нажал другую клавишу или щелкаю мышью.

Кто-либо знает, как решить эту проблему?

7
задан 22.10.2010, 17:11

1 ответ

Я хотел бы, переключают Alt и Ctrl, потому что я в настоящее время - пользователь Mac на Окне (с клавиатурой компьютера). Все горячие клавиши на Mac: Cmd+n, Cmd+w...-> ПК: Ctrl+n, Ctrl+w и Cmd получили то же место как клавиша Alt.

Я нашел не идеальное решение:

Отобразите все буквы как этот:

LAlt & a::Send {LCtrl Down}{a}{LCtrl Up}
...
LAlt & z::Send {LCtrl Down}{z}{LCtrl Up}
LCtrl & a::Send {LAlt Down}{a}{LAlt Up}
...
LCtrl & z::Send {LAlt Down}{z}{LAlt Up}

И Вы сохраните Alt+Tab и AltGr функциональными

Это - мое полное внедрение (не завершенный): http://www.pastie.org/1660132

4
ответ дан 07.12.2019, 14:57

Теги

Похожие вопросы